Skip to content

Commit 02bcadd

Browse files
committed
ADD: [convers, main] Remember window position.
1 parent 58b2962 commit 02bcadd

File tree

16 files changed

+1601
-1389
lines changed

16 files changed

+1601
-1389
lines changed

CHANGELOG.md

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,8 @@
1616
- FIX: [editor] Send correkt CRLF.
1717
- DEL: [editor] Remove shortcut from SEND Button.
1818
- ADD: [convers] Seperate window for convers.
19+
- ADD: [convers, main] Remember window position.
20+
- ADD: [tray] Button to show convers window.
1921

2022
## v0.7.0
2123

assets/images/Exit_02_24.png

822 Bytes
Loading

src/flexpacket.lpi

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@
2323
<UseVersionInfo Value="True"/>
2424
<AutoIncrementBuild Value="True"/>
2525
<MinorVersionNr Value="7"/>
26-
<BuildNr Value="2390"/>
26+
<BuildNr Value="2395"/>
2727
<Language Value="0C0C"/>
2828
<StringTable InternalName="flexpacket" ProductName="flexpacket" ProductVersion="0.7.0"/>
2929
</VersionInfo>

src/flexpacket.lps

Lines changed: 87 additions & 51 deletions
Original file line numberDiff line numberDiff line change
@@ -18,9 +18,10 @@
1818
<HasResources Value="True"/>
1919
<ResourceBaseClass Value="Form"/>
2020
<UnitName Value="UMain"/>
21+
<IsVisibleTab Value="True"/>
2122
<EditorIndex Value="15"/>
22-
<TopLine Value="997"/>
23-
<CursorPos X="5" Y="1010"/>
23+
<TopLine Value="112"/>
24+
<CursorPos X="52" Y="116"/>
2425
<UsageCount Value="210"/>
2526
<Loaded Value="True"/>
2627
<LoadedDesigner Value="True"/>
@@ -61,8 +62,8 @@
6162
<Filename Value="utypes.pas"/>
6263
<IsPartOfProject Value="True"/>
6364
<EditorIndex Value="19"/>
64-
<TopLine Value="254"/>
65-
<CursorPos X="33" Y="261"/>
65+
<TopLine Value="81"/>
66+
<CursorPos X="12" Y="110"/>
6667
<UsageCount Value="357"/>
6768
<Loaded Value="True"/>
6869
</Unit>
@@ -104,8 +105,8 @@
104105
<Filename Value="uini.pas"/>
105106
<IsPartOfProject Value="True"/>
106107
<EditorIndex Value="11"/>
107-
<TopLine Value="113"/>
108-
<CursorPos X="83" Y="134"/>
108+
<TopLine Value="58"/>
109+
<CursorPos X="33" Y="72"/>
109110
<UsageCount Value="202"/>
110111
<Loaded Value="True"/>
111112
</Unit>
@@ -240,7 +241,7 @@
240241
<HasResources Value="True"/>
241242
<ResourceBaseClass Value="Form"/>
242243
<EditorIndex Value="7"/>
243-
<TopLine Value="110"/>
244+
<TopLine Value="108"/>
244245
<CursorPos X="50" Y="119"/>
245246
<UsageCount Value="267"/>
246247
<Loaded Value="True"/>
@@ -252,10 +253,9 @@
252253
<ComponentName Value="TFConvers"/>
253254
<HasResources Value="True"/>
254255
<ResourceBaseClass Value="Form"/>
255-
<IsVisibleTab Value="True"/>
256256
<EditorIndex Value="6"/>
257-
<TopLine Value="63"/>
258-
<CursorPos X="46" Y="215"/>
257+
<TopLine Value="154"/>
258+
<CursorPos Y="158"/>
259259
<UsageCount Value="247"/>
260260
<Loaded Value="True"/>
261261
<LoadedDesigner Value="True"/>
@@ -322,90 +322,126 @@
322322
<UsageCount Value="3"/>
323323
</Unit>
324324
</Units>
325-
<JumpHistory HistoryIndex="20">
325+
<JumpHistory HistoryIndex="29">
326326
<Position>
327327
<Filename Value="uconvers.pas"/>
328-
<Caret Line="281" Column="54" TopLine="262"/>
328+
<Caret Line="324" TopLine="300"/>
329329
</Position>
330330
<Position>
331-
<Filename Value="ulistmails.pas"/>
332-
<Caret Line="440" Column="18" TopLine="114"/>
331+
<Filename Value="uconvers.pas"/>
332+
<Caret Line="154" TopLine="148"/>
333333
</Position>
334334
<Position>
335-
<Filename Value="ulistmails.pas"/>
336-
<Caret Line="195" Column="12" TopLine="192"/>
335+
<Filename Value="umain.pas"/>
336+
<Caret Line="664" Column="31" TopLine="661"/>
337337
</Position>
338338
<Position>
339-
<Filename Value="ulistmails.pas"/>
340-
<Caret Line="50" Column="15" TopLine="36"/>
339+
<Filename Value="umain.pas"/>
340+
<Caret Line="600" Column="31" TopLine="593"/>
341341
</Position>
342342
<Position>
343-
<Filename Value="uconvers.pas"/>
344-
<Caret Line="162" Column="37" TopLine="161"/>
343+
<Filename Value="umain.pas"/>
344+
<Caret Line="860" TopLine="858"/>
345345
</Position>
346346
<Position>
347-
<Filename Value="uconvers.pas"/>
348-
<Caret Line="144" TopLine="130"/>
347+
<Filename Value="umain.pas"/>
348+
<Caret Line="597" Column="3" TopLine="593"/>
349349
</Position>
350350
<Position>
351-
<Filename Value="uconvers.pas"/>
352-
<Caret Line="288" TopLine="104"/>
351+
<Filename Value="umain.pas"/>
352+
<Caret Line="862" TopLine="858"/>
353353
</Position>
354354
<Position>
355-
<Filename Value="uconvers.pas"/>
356-
<Caret Line="160" Column="5" TopLine="145"/>
355+
<Filename Value="umain.pas"/>
356+
<Caret Line="1504" TopLine="1490"/>
357357
</Position>
358358
<Position>
359359
<Filename Value="uconvers.pas"/>
360-
<Caret Line="68" Column="3" TopLine="69"/>
360+
<Caret Line="105" Column="15" TopLine="175"/>
361361
</Position>
362362
<Position>
363-
<Filename Value="uconvers.pas"/>
364-
<Caret Line="67" Column="3" TopLine="68"/>
363+
<Filename Value="umain.pas"/>
364+
<Caret Line="137" Column="47" TopLine="134"/>
365365
</Position>
366366
<Position>
367-
<Filename Value="uconvers.pas"/>
368-
<Caret Line="66" Column="3" TopLine="67"/>
367+
<Filename Value="umain.pas"/>
368+
<Caret Line="597" Column="11" TopLine="591"/>
369369
</Position>
370370
<Position>
371-
<Filename Value="uconvers.pas"/>
372-
<Caret Line="65" Column="3" TopLine="66"/>
371+
<Filename Value="umain.pas"/>
372+
<Caret Line="96" Column="44" TopLine="88"/>
373373
</Position>
374374
<Position>
375-
<Filename Value="uconvers.pas"/>
376-
<Caret Line="64" Column="3" TopLine="65"/>
375+
<Filename Value="umain.pas"/>
376+
<Caret Line="117" Column="29" TopLine="93"/>
377377
</Position>
378378
<Position>
379-
<Filename Value="uconvers.pas"/>
380-
<Caret Line="63" Column="3" TopLine="64"/>
379+
<Filename Value="umain.pas"/>
380+
<Caret Line="234" Column="30" TopLine="210"/>
381381
</Position>
382382
<Position>
383-
<Filename Value="uconvers.pas"/>
384-
<Caret Line="62" Column="3" TopLine="63"/>
383+
<Filename Value="umain.pas"/>
384+
<Caret Line="253" Column="30" TopLine="229"/>
385385
</Position>
386386
<Position>
387-
<Filename Value="uconvers.pas"/>
388-
<Caret Line="61" Column="3" TopLine="62"/>
387+
<Filename Value="umain.pas"/>
388+
<Caret Line="268" Column="30" TopLine="244"/>
389389
</Position>
390390
<Position>
391-
<Filename Value="uconvers.pas"/>
392-
<Caret Line="66" Column="26" TopLine="50"/>
391+
<Filename Value="umain.pas"/>
392+
<Caret Line="309" Column="60" TopLine="285"/>
393393
</Position>
394394
<Position>
395-
<Filename Value="uconvers.pas"/>
396-
<Caret Line="72" Column="43" TopLine="65"/>
395+
<Filename Value="umain.pas"/>
396+
<Caret Line="333" Column="23" TopLine="309"/>
397397
</Position>
398398
<Position>
399-
<Filename Value="uconvers.pas"/>
400-
<Caret Line="212" Column="55" TopLine="192"/>
399+
<Filename Value="umain.pas"/>
400+
<Caret Line="344" Column="60" TopLine="320"/>
401401
</Position>
402402
<Position>
403-
<Filename Value="uconvers.pas"/>
404-
<Caret Line="196" Column="57" TopLine="194"/>
403+
<Filename Value="umain.pas"/>
404+
<Caret Line="596" Column="32" TopLine="572"/>
405405
</Position>
406406
<Position>
407-
<Filename Value="ucmdboxcustom.pas"/>
408-
<Caret Line="8" Column="26"/>
407+
<Filename Value="umain.pas"/>
408+
<Caret Line="597" Column="32" TopLine="573"/>
409+
</Position>
410+
<Position>
411+
<Filename Value="umain.pas"/>
412+
<Caret Line="1029" Column="46" TopLine="1005"/>
413+
</Position>
414+
<Position>
415+
<Filename Value="umain.pas"/>
416+
<Caret Line="1030" Column="26" TopLine="1006"/>
417+
</Position>
418+
<Position>
419+
<Filename Value="umain.pas"/>
420+
<Caret Line="1031" Column="32" TopLine="1007"/>
421+
</Position>
422+
<Position>
423+
<Filename Value="umain.pas"/>
424+
<Caret Line="598" Column="25" TopLine="583"/>
425+
</Position>
426+
<Position>
427+
<Filename Value="umain.pas"/>
428+
<Caret Line="609" Column="9" TopLine="583"/>
429+
</Position>
430+
<Position>
431+
<Filename Value="umain.pas"/>
432+
<Caret Line="1511" TopLine="1497"/>
433+
</Position>
434+
<Position>
435+
<Filename Value="umain.pas"/>
436+
<Caret Line="480" Column="36" TopLine="475"/>
437+
</Position>
438+
<Position>
439+
<Filename Value="umain.pas"/>
440+
<Caret Line="608" TopLine="590"/>
441+
</Position>
442+
<Position>
443+
<Filename Value="umain.pas"/>
444+
<Caret Line="605" Column="8" TopLine="580"/>
409445
</Position>
410446
</JumpHistory>
411447
<RunParams>

src/flexpacket.res

0 Bytes
Binary file not shown.

src/i18n/flexpacket.pot

Lines changed: 9 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-275,6 +275,11 @@ msgstr ""
275275
msgid "actListMails"
276276
msgstr ""
277277

278+
#: tfmain.actmainshowhide.caption
279+
msgctxt "tfmain.actmainshowhide.caption"
280+
msgid "Show/Hide"
281+
msgstr ""
282+
278283
#: tfmain.actopenconvers.caption
279284
msgctxt "tfmain.actopenconvers.caption"
280285
msgid "Convers"
@@ -334,11 +339,6 @@ msgstr ""
334339
msgid "Enable"
335340
msgstr ""
336341

337-
#: tfmain.mishowhide.caption
338-
msgctxt "tfmain.mishowhide.caption"
339-
msgid "Show/Hide"
340-
msgstr ""
341-
342342
#: tfmain.mitoolbarsize.caption
343343
msgid "Toogle Toolbar Icon Size"
344344
msgstr ""
@@ -497,6 +497,10 @@ msgctxt "ttfconvers.toolbar1.caption"
497497
msgid "ToolBar1"
498498
msgstr ""
499499

500+
#: ttfconvers.toolbutton1.caption
501+
msgid "ToolButton1"
502+
msgstr ""
503+
500504
#: ttfeditor.actclose.caption
501505
msgctxt "ttfeditor.actclose.caption"
502506
msgid "Close"

src/uconvers.lfm

Lines changed: 9 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,6 @@ object TFConvers: TTFConvers
66
Caption = 'FlexPacket - Convers'
77
ClientHeight = 530
88
ClientWidth = 660
9-
DockSite = True
109
DoubleBuffered = True
1110
ParentDoubleBuffered = False
1211
Position = poOwnerFormCenter
@@ -35,10 +34,17 @@ object TFConvers: TTFConvers
3534
AutoSize = True
3635
end
3736
object TBConnect: TToolButton
38-
Left = 27
37+
Left = 35
3938
Top = 0
4039
Action = actConnect
4140
end
41+
object ToolButton1: TToolButton
42+
Left = 27
43+
Height = 26
44+
Top = 0
45+
Caption = 'ToolButton1'
46+
Style = tbsSeparator
47+
end
4248
end
4349
object StatusBar1: TStatusBar
4450
Left = 0
@@ -121,7 +127,7 @@ object TFConvers: TTFConvers
121127
object actClose: TAction
122128
Caption = 'Close'
123129
Hint = 'Close'
124-
ImageIndex = 16
130+
ImageIndex = 34
125131
OnExecute = actCloseExecute
126132
end
127133
object actConnect: TAction

src/uconvers.lrj

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
{"version":1,"strings":[
22
{"hash":191791235,"name":"ttfconvers.caption","sourcebytes":[70,108,101,120,80,97,99,107,101,116,32,45,32,67,111,110,118,101,114,115],"value":"FlexPacket - Convers"},
33
{"hash":106991073,"name":"ttfconvers.toolbar1.caption","sourcebytes":[84,111,111,108,66,97,114,49],"value":"ToolBar1"},
4+
{"hash":160486417,"name":"ttfconvers.toolbutton1.caption","sourcebytes":[84,111,111,108,66,117,116,116,111,110,49],"value":"ToolButton1"},
45
{"hash":4863637,"name":"ttfconvers.actclose.caption","sourcebytes":[67,108,111,115,101],"value":"Close"},
56
{"hash":4863637,"name":"ttfconvers.actclose.hint","sourcebytes":[67,108,111,115,101],"value":"Close"},
67
{"hash":174410724,"name":"ttfconvers.actconnect.caption","sourcebytes":[67,111,110,110,101,99,116],"value":"Connect"},

0 commit comments

Comments
 (0)